> Adding arbitrary metadata to a Knox Token

> We would need to enhance our GET API to accept an arbitrary list of key/value 
> pairs as Knox token metadata. At the time of this Jira is being created, the 
> following hard-coded metadata exists for a Knox Token:
>  * userName
>  * comment
>  * enabled
>  * passcode
> The plan is to modify our TokenResource to accept query parameters starting 
> with the ‘{{{}md_{}}}’ prefix and treat them as Knox Token Metadata. For 
> instance:
> {noformat}
> curl -iku admin:admin-password -X GET 
> 'https://localhost:8443/gateway/sandbox/knoxtoken/api/v1/token?md_notebookName=accountantKnoxToken&md_souldBeRemovedBy=31March2022&md_otherMeaningfuMetadata=KnoxIsCool'{noformat}
> When such a token is created by Knox, we should save the following metadata 
> too:
>  * {{notebookName=accountantKnoxToken}}
>  * {{shouldBeRemovedBy=31March2022}}
>  * {{otherMeaningfulMetadata=KnoxIsCool}}
> It’s not only Knox will be able to save these metadata, but we have to update 
> our existing {{getUserTokens}} API endpoint to be able to fetch basic token 
> information (see 
> {{{}org.apache.knox.gateway.services.security.token.KnoxToken{}}}) using the 
> supplied metadata name besides the user name information.
> For instance:
> {noformat}
> curl -iku admin:admin-password -X GET 
> 'https://localhost:8443/gateway/sandbox/knoxtoken/api/v1/token/getUserTokens?userName=admin&mdName=notebookName&mdValue=accountantKnoxToken'{noformat}
> will return all Knox tokens where metadata with _‘notebookName’_ exists and 
> equals {_}‘accountantKnoxToken’{_}.
> Finally, the Token Management page should display metadata too.
